I wrote a buggy patch that crashed JP, but these just showed up as timeouts in TBPL, which is deceptive, and makes the machine sit there for 5 minutes waiting for the timeout:
  https://tbpl.mozilla.org/?tree=Try&rev=f3122d33c773

Run locally, it shows this in the log:

 0:08.41 Hit MOZ_CRASH() at /home/amccreight/icc/memory/mozjemalloc/jemalloc.c:1572
 0:08.41 
 0:08.41 Program ./dist/bin/firefox-bin (pid = 12946) received signal 11.
 0:08.41 Stack:
... (the stack isn't fully symbolicated, but that's probably a separate bug...)
 0:08.41 Sleeping for 300 seconds.
 0:08.41 Type 'gdb ./dist/bin/firefox-bin 12946' to attach your debugger to this thread.
